How about this circuit for driving a Mosfet power follower?
ECC86 is the european version of 6GM8, before anyone misreads and asks why I´m using ECC88 (6DJ8) at such low plate voltage.
A short explanation of the schematic:
The triode is of course the actual gain device, operating at 15V 2mA. The plate is loaded with a 2SK170-based CCS and direct coupled to a cascoded Jfet White follower.
This *should* give that whimpy little triode pretty much optimal circumstances to do it´s job as a voltage gain stage.
IME this tube is hardly capable of driving anything by itself, but this follower should be a very easy load. |
